Engineering Quiet Mobility: The Rise of Noise Vibration Harshness Materials

The Noise Vibration Harshness Materials sector is becoming increasingly vital in the automotive industry as manufacturers strive to deliver superior ride quality and acoustic comfort. These materials are specifically designed to absorb, dampen, and isolate unwanted noise and vibrations that can negatively impact the driving experience.

Noise vibration harshness materials encompass a wide range of products, including acoustic foams, rubber isolators, damping sheets, and barrier materials. Each type serves a distinct function, working together to create a quieter and smoother vehicle environment. Their application extends to multiple areas such as engine bays, cabins, trunks, and underbody panels.

As vehicles become more technologically advanced, the importance of NVH performance continues to grow. Consumers now expect vehicles to offer not only performance and efficiency but also a refined and peaceful cabin atmosphere. This has led to increased research and development efforts aimed at enhancing material efficiency while reducing overall vehicle weight.

The emergence of electric and hybrid vehicles has further emphasized the role of noise vibration harshness materials. With the absence of traditional engine noise, even minor disturbances become more noticeable, requiring advanced solutions to maintain acoustic balance. Engineers are focusing on innovative material compositions and multi-layered structures to achieve optimal results.

Sustainability is another key trend influencing the market. Manufacturers are exploring eco-friendly materials that meet both performance and environmental standards. Recycled fibers and bio-based materials are gaining popularity as they align with global sustainability goals while delivering effective NVH performance.

The growing demand for premium vehicles, coupled with stricter noise regulations, is expected to drive the adoption of noise vibration harshness materials worldwide. As automotive design continues to evolve, these materials will play an essential role in enhancing comfort, safety, and overall vehicle quality.
